Post-Op Rehab After Joint Replacement: Moving Toward Full Recovery 💪🦵

Recovery doesn’t stop at reducing swelling or rebuilding strength. After joint replacement surgery, functional movements are key to getting you back to everyday life.

Functional movements mirror the activities you do daily—walking, reaching, lifting, standing, and climbing stairs. These movements help train your body to use your new joint safely and efficiently in real-life situations.

Our therapists create individualized rehab programs that focus on:
✔️ Balance and coordination
✔️ Safe movement patterns
✔️ Overall mobility and confidence

By practicing functional movements, patients regain independence, reduce the risk of future injuries, and feel more confident returning to normal routines—whether it’s going back to work, taking daily walks, or enjoying favorite hobbies.

🦵 Post-Op Rehab for Joint Replacement: Let’s Keep the Swelling Down!

Recovering from a joint replacement surgery is a journey — and controlling swelling plays a big role in making that journey smoother, more comfortable, and less painful. 💙

✨ Why manage swelling?
Reducing swelling helps improve mobility, decrease pain, and set the stage for faster healing. Small, consistent steps can make a big impact on your recovery progress.

✨ Simple techniques that work:
❄️ Ice Therapy – Helps reduce inflammation and numbs discomfort.
🌀 Compression – Supports the joint and prevents fluid buildup.
🦶 Elevation – Lifts the joint above heart level to ease swelling naturally.

🍁 Stay Steady, Stay Safe: Your Fall Prevention Plan Starts Today! 🍁

Falls can happen to anyone—but they are largely preventable with the right habits and support. Protect yourself and your loved ones by taking simple, proactive steps each day.

🦶 Why Fall Prevention Matters
Falls can lead to injuries, reduced mobility, and loss of independence. A personalized fall prevention plan helps you stay confident, active, and safe.

🛡️ Key Steps in Your Fall Prevention Plan:
✨ 1. Strength & Balance Exercises
Building muscle strength and improving balance reduces your risk of falling. Even simple daily exercises make a big difference!

✨ 2. Safe Home Setup
Remove clutter, secure loose rugs, improve lighting, and install grab bars where needed.

✨ 3. Proper Footwear
Wear shoes with good grip and support. Avoid slippers or footwear that easily slides.

✨ 4. Regular Vision Checks
Clear vision is essential for safe movement—schedule routine eye exams.

✨ 5. Medication Review
Some medications cause dizziness or drowsiness. Talk to your doctor or pharmacist regularly.

✨ 6. Support When Needed
Use canes, walkers, or handrails—these tools maintain independence and safety.
